FieldScribe's offline mode queues survey submissions locally and syncs them once connectivity returns; support agents should confirm the sync badge shows green before escalating data-loss reports. Conflicts resolve in favor of the most recent edit timestamp. To inspect a customer's sync queue via the internal Relaybridge diagnostics endpoint, use the key below.

gateway credential: kto23_LX9A4ys6i4nzHtpOLNLodKK

The proposed franchise agreement with Denridge Hospitality Group has been reviewed against standard terms. Upfront fees align with our Tier 2 schedule; ongoing royalties are set at the lower band, offset by a marketing levy. Working-capital requirements for the first three Denridge sites are funded from the regional expansion reserve. Audit rights and termination clauses meet policy. One open item: indemnity caps remain under negotiation.

Finance team members should note the confidential commentary on expansion plans appended directly below.

board note of bawep-tajef: Queniusek Systems plans to raise the Quenvan list price by 53.1 percent in March. The pricing group signed off on a budget of $176.4 million for Project Drueth. The renewal with Casionix Partners closes at $142.5 million a year, 8.3 percent below the last contract. Project Fraax slips by six weeks because of the tooling delay.

### Retrying failed exports (Lanternfile pipeline)

When an export job in the Lanternfile pipeline lands in the FAILED queue, do not simply re-run it. First confirm the upstream snapshot in Corvid Storage is complete, then requeue with `export-retry --safe`, which preserves idempotency keys and avoids duplicate rows downstream. Limit retries to three attempts before escalating to the data platform rotation. Attach the trace token printed directly below to your escalation note.

trace token, fafog-kageg: htk4_98e6